POST: LIBRARIAN REF NO: RECRUIT 2023/217: National Prosecutions Services

  • SALARY : R269 214 per annum (Level 07), (excluding benefits)
  • CENTRE : DDPP: Thohoyandou

REQUIREMENTS: An appropriate B Degree (NQF 7)/ Three (3) year Diploma (NQF 6). At least two years relevant experience preferable in a law library environment. Demonstrable competency in acting Independently, Professionally, Accountable and with Credibility Ability to work on an electronic library management system including eBooks. Computer literacy in MS Word, Excel, and PowerPoint. At least two years’ experience in utilization of search of search including Jutastat, Lexis Nexis, Sabinet and WorldShare. Willingness to travel. Valid driver’s license.

DUTIES: Catalog and classify library material utilising available databases. Maintain asset register of library material including disposals. Renew standing orders. Conduct inter and intra-Library loans. Conduct periodic stock take and keep statistics. Procure and process new material for both head office and regions. Loose leaf administration. Liaise with external clients. Assist with information projects of the NPA. Process all requests in terms of law reports, statutes and reference material. Assist with training of clients in use of online databases. Submit monthly reports.
